Background story

The GBU-24 is a high precission LASER guided bomb derived from the Paveway series. Its development goes back to the year 1965 and was initiated by Texas Instruments after the Bell Laboratories had developped the necessary LASER. The first successful applications of this weapon were achieved after enormous failures in e.g. Beirut 1983, in 1986 during the attack of Libya after the Lockerby terrorist attacks. Later in the golf wars the americans had spectacular success with the laser guided bunker busters.

Since June 2010 there are no more Tornados at FBW 31 when the last one left for Büchel airbase, home of FBW 33. FBW 31 has converted to the new Eurofighter.
